Read and Understand Fairy Tales & Folktales, Grades 1-2
35
 
 

Read and Understand Fairy Tales & Folktales, Grades 1-2Read and Understand Fairy Tales & Folktales, Grades 1-2

These stories have been handed down through many generations, sometimes by word of mouth and other times in writing. Peopled by talking animals, witches, giants, trolls, and other fantastic creatures, the appeal they hold for young readers makes them ideal focal points for learning and discussion.

This volume features 23 one-to-three-page stories, each followed by three to four pages of activities that build reading skills. These stories, borrowed from diverse cultures, vary in reading difficulty from first through beginning third grade to meet a range of needs.

Women In Business (Penguin Graded Readers Level 4)
204
 
 

Women In Business (Penguin Graded Readers Level 4)Women in Business
Penguin Graded Readers (Level 4)
In Women in Business, we see how five women made it to the top in the twentieth century. These women are famous all over the world. They are each from very different cultures and backgrounds but they all have one thing in common – success.

Explore on Your Own: Animals of Denali (Pioneer Edition + Pathfinder Edition)
13
 
 

Explore on Your Own: Animals of Denali (Pioneer Edition + Pathfinder Edition)Adventure with the wild animals and people of the Denali National Park in Alaska through the changing seasons.
The best articles from National Geographic Explorer Magazine are now compiled in single-topic books with identical content at two different reading levels: Pioneer (grades 2-3) and Pathfinder (grades 4-6). These books cover a broad range of topics as well as include engaging graphics and compelling images. You can introduce science and social studies content while truly providing differentiated texts in your classroom.
